NortheastArc-Clinical Services is a nonprofit Medicaid/Medicare-certified home healthcare agency founded in 2003. Our mission is to serve medically fragile pediatric and adult populations in cities and towns across Bristol, Essex, Middlesex, Norfolk, Plymouth, and Suffolk Counties.

Here are some key points about our services:

  • Nursing Opportunities: We’re always seeking compassionate nurses to join our team. Whether you’re an RN, LPN, or a new grad, you’re welcome to apply. Worried about losing skills? Our diverse cases ensure that nurses gain valuable experience across various medical conditions.
  • We specialize in providing Continuous Care Nursing for medically complex children and adults. Our nurses work 1-on-1 with patients in their homes, schools, or community settings. Our goal is to help families navigate the complexities of their loved one’s medical care, ensuring patients can stay at home and avoid hospitalization.
  • Diverse Cases: Our cases cover a wide spectrum, from general nursing care to extremely complex ICU-level home care. Most of our patients face feeding challenges and are either G or J-tube feeding dependent. Others may have tracheostomies requiring ventilator support, seizure disorders, ostomy appliances, wound management needs, or diabetic maintenance.
